Job description

Company Description TJS Studysteps PK is committed to offering exceptional educational consultancy services, helping students secure placements in top-ranking universities in Malaysia. Our goal is to guide students toward achieving their academic aspirations through personalized counseling and support. Located in Lahore, Pakistan, we deliver comprehensive services tailored to individual educational and career goals. We are passionate about empowering students to succeed in their academic journeys. Role Description This is a full-time on-site role based in Islamabad for a Student Counsellor. The Student Counsellor will provide guidance to students regarding educational opportunities, assist with career counseling, and facilitate admissions processes. Key responsibilities include understanding student needs, offering professional advice and assistance, communicating with partner institutions, and providing outstanding customer service to address student and parent inquiries. Maintaining accurate records and staying updated on educational trends will also be part of the role. Qualifications Proven expertise in Student Counseling and Career Counseling to guide students in achieving their educational and career objectives. Strong Communication and Customer Service skills to effectively interact with students, parents, and institutions. Knowledge of Education systems and processes, specifically admissions and international higher education standards. Excellent organizational and interpersonal skills to manage diverse student profiles and handle multiple tasks efficiently. Bachelor's degree in Education, Psychology, or a related field is preferred. Familiarity with educational opportunities in Malaysia will be considered an asset.
